Output 76c8e264ead2e22e68844b1676ac0c6964675777ac3b82265a1f3ae8d50c5a99:0

value
288666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ff2e94f7e45e3186bac454144cbc1705a2d7ef1d OP_EQUAL
address
3QxJ32b5HWgQAbR4fPKusMtBBHfszzHYkx
transaction
76c8e264ead2e22e68844b1676ac0c6964675777ac3b82265a1f3ae8d50c5a99
spent
true